Energy Efficiency
9, Admiral Close, Bristol has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 13 Sep 2019.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 9, Admiral Close, Bristol completed on 8th August 2025 at £530,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 the property has sold 7 times.
Values of comparable properties have dropped by 11.1% over the period since August 2025.
